Recipe: Braised Short Ribs wtih Green Pepper (My Great Recipes Card#66 in Group#10)
Main Dishes - Beef and Other MeatsBRAISED SHORT RIBS WITH GREEN PEPPER
Source: My Great Recipes card collection (printed in Holland)
Beef, Card 66 , Group 10
Prep time: 20 minutes
Cook time: 2 1/2 hours
Temp: 350
You brown, then slowly bake, meaty short ribs until they are tender to make a hearty winter meal for family or friends.
For 4 servings:
2 1/2 to 3 lbs beef short ribs
1/3 cup all-purpose flour
1 tsp salt
3/4 tsp black pepper
2 Tbsp vegetable shortening
1 cup sliced onions
1 clove garlic, minced or pressed
1 cup hot water
1 bay leaf
2 Tbsp brown sugar, packed
1/4 cup vinegar
2 Tbsp soy sauce
1 green pepper, cut into rings
All-purpose flour, optional
1. Wipe meat with a damp cloth. Trim off excess fat.
2. Combine flour, salt and black pepper. Dredge meat in mixture to coat completely. Heat shortening in large skillet. Brown ribs on all sides. Remove to a casserole with a cover.
3. Cook onions and garlic in skillet until golden. Spoon over ribs. Combine water, bay leaf, brown sugar, vinegar and soy sauce. Pour over ribs.
4. Cover and bake at 350 degrees F for 2 hours. Add green pepper rings. Cook 30 minutes longer or until meat is tender.
5. Remove cooked ribs and vegetables to a serving platter. Skim fat off drippings. Thicken with a little flour if desired. Spoon drippings over meat and vegetables.
Good served with: Hot buttered noodles, mashed potatoes or rice, and a green salad.
For 8 servings: Double the ingredients. Use 1-1/2 cups host water.
For 2 servings: Half of the ingredients.
